Transaction 7971496ed2a7a9164a93f16b7948bfd9de0b75e70b16749870950b92ccc53a99
1 Input
1 Output
-
7971496ed2a7a9164a93f16b7948bfd9de0b75e70b16749870950b92ccc53a99:0
- value
- 599260
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 667fb6ea9cbeaa03ff9634e4de0cf6144be69f8b64a8b4d1f130f9b4aec16dbc
- address
- bc1pvelmd65uh64q8lukxnjdur8kz397d8utvj5tf503xrumftkpdk7q3eft5p